Suzlon bags 58.80 MW repeat turnkey order from leading Independent Power Producer

21 Jul 2016 Evaluate

Suzlon Group, one of the leading global renewable energy solution providers, has won a repeat order from leading Independent Power Producer (IPP) for a 58.80 MW capacity wind power project in Madhya Pradesh, in India. The project comprises of 28 units of S97-120 m hybrid towers with rated capacity of 2.1 MW each and is scheduled for completion by March 2017.

Suzlon will be responsible for the entire project lifecycle which includes wind turbine supply, construction and commissioning as well as operations, maintenance and services of the project for a period of 12 years. The project is capable of powering 32,000 households and reducing 0.12 million tonnes of C02 emissions per annum. The S97 120m hybrid tower is a combination of the lattice and tubular towers wind turbine generator (WTG) with increased stability and reduced cost. It enables higher generation from low wind sites and yields higher return-on-investment to customers.

Suzlon Group is one of the leading renewable energy solutions providers in the world with an international presence across 19 countries in Asia, Australia, Europe, Africa and North and South America.
